Skip to main content

heddle_client/
auth_requests.rs

1//! Typed requests for `heddle auth` handlers.
2
3#[derive(Clone, Debug)]
4pub enum AuthCommand {
5    Login {
6        server: String,
7        no_browser: bool,
8    },
9    Logout {
10        server: Option<String>,
11    },
12    Status {
13        server: Option<String>,
14    },
15    CreateServiceToken {
16        name: String,
17        namespace: String,
18        server: Option<String>,
19    },
20}